On a Theorem of Erdos, Rubin, and Taylor on Choosability of Complete Bipartite Graphs
نویسنده
چکیده
Erdős, Rubin, and Taylor found a nice correspondence between the minimum order of a complete bipartite graph that is not r-choosable and the minimum number of edges in an r-uniform hypergraph that is not 2-colorable (in the ordinary sense). In this note we use their ideas to derive similar correspondences for complete kpartite graphs and complete k-uniform k-partite hypergraphs.

A biclique of a graph G is an induced complete bipartite graph. A star of G is a biclique contained in the closed neighborhood of a vertex. A star (biclique) k-coloring of G is a k-coloring of G that contains no monochromatic maximal stars (bicliques).
